You cannot throw TVs, monitors, computers, or other electronics in the regular trash in most cities — they contain lead, mercury, and other hazardous materials that require certified recycling. Your options for TV removal and e-waste disposal: city e-waste drop-off events (free but infrequent), retailer take-back programs (free for small items), self-haul to a recycling center (free–$30), curbside pickup through Dropcurb ($99, same day), or traditional junk removal ($150–400+).

City program details: Apple Valley trash service is provided through Burrtec. Bulky items require direct scheduling with Burrtec at (760) 245-8607, and special collection events for appliances, tires, and mattresses are announced by the Town.
Apple Valley residents can use Burrtec bulky pickup, but the town directs residents to call and schedule directly, and many special streams like appliance, tire, and mattress events are periodic rather than instant. The town also runs a household hazardous waste site with strict limits and Saturday-only hours, so timing matters during move-outs, HOA cleanup notices, and renovation turnover. What happens to your electronics after pickup
Electronics are recycled at R2- or e-Stewards-certified e-waste facilities. Devices are disassembled and sorted: circuit boards are processed for gold, silver, copper, and palladium recovery. Screens are separated for glass and lead processing. Plastics are shredded and recycled. Hard drives, SSDs, and other storage media are physically destroyed (shredded or degaussed) to ensure complete data destruction — no data leaves the facility intact. The $20 e-waste recycling fee covers the cost of certified handling and hazardous material processing.
